dom/base/nsFocusManager.h
eeb943d179c5bc20052df881238c938b1ff5f7dd
created 2014-11-27 08:28 -0500
pushed 2014-11-28 00:42 +0000
Neil Deakin Neil Deakin - Bug 1072342, propagate the window activation state down to child process windows, r=smaug,mstange
8be6765c7d5581eba5790c2d5585e2deb01729ea
created 2014-06-18 15:13 +0900
pushed 2014-06-18 12:19 +0000
Masayuki Nakano Masayuki Nakano - Bug 976673 part.4 Allow nested mouse button event handling for modal dialog r=smaug+enndeakin
43d1907bd36134b1093e6b98f0c7f75113a816f4
created 2014-06-18 15:13 +0900
pushed 2014-06-18 12:19 +0000
Masayuki Nakano Masayuki Nakano - Bug 976673 part.2 Allow to steal focus by JS at handling mouseup event r=enndeakin
41937f231795e696b18b14b3b22833973f371996
created 2013-11-24 21:35 +0200
pushed 2013-11-25 01:46 +0000
Olli Pettay Olli Pettay - Bug 942240 - Improve the skippability of nsGlobalWindow, r=mccr8
28e8a3bbe870514b0425e467d5e70351e39540b7
created 2013-10-28 10:04 -0400
pushed 2013-10-28 23:57 +0000
Birunthan Mohanathas Birunthan Mohanathas - Bug 784739 - Switch from NULL to nullptr in dom/ (1/2); r=ehsan
76d9db6490f4d7efaf40ed88bcdc8f7d316ad2f3
created 2013-05-22 12:28 +0900
pushed 2013-05-22 16:29 +0000
Masayuki Nakano Masayuki Nakano - Bug 396542 nsFocusManager should restore caret browsing mode when an editor loses focus r=ehsan
1547d8556df7b4a3f31c8f00c1a438b7bf7fe172
created 2013-04-21 11:30 +0100
pushed 2013-04-22 12:30 +0000
Jonathan Watt Jonathan Watt - Backout bug 862693 (Stop the :-moz-focusring pseudo-class from matching if an element is themed and the theme will display a visual indication of focus for the element. r=roc)
23d89270390d369c265a8389099cc9a4cf6c9e78
created 2013-04-17 09:22 +0100
pushed 2013-04-17 16:44 +0000
Jonathan Watt Jonathan Watt - Bug 862693 - Stop the :-moz-focusring pseudo-class from matching if an element is themed and the theme will display a visual indication of focus for the element. r=roc
c656d41192f65397aff67d74b1472443b47f23cc
created 2013-03-24 12:32 +0200
pushed 2013-03-25 00:58 +0000
Olli Pettay Olli Pettay - Bug 737100 - Extend Pointer Lock (Mouse Lock) for non-fullscreen elements, p=smaug,dolske, r=cpearce,dolske,smaug
c1e0d7e7b16461eafdbdb3c0f0b4e0e9f39c3bcc
created 2013-03-21 20:05 -0400
pushed 2013-03-22 14:00 +0000
David Zbarsky David Zbarsky - Bug 847007: Remove nsIContent includes r=Ms2ger
c4f83d9d8243f3f853a5356188164a5fddee2b5a
created 2012-08-22 16:09 -0700
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Merge from mozilla-central.
87e239ca45c65753eaf4e6c0f6c451cf420bd9f3
created 2012-06-23 08:35 -0400
pushed 2012-09-11 17:34 +0000
Ryan VanderMeulen Ryan VanderMeulen - Merge the last PGO-green inbound changeset to m-c.
881c4b8e74045a4033f68ec402c245f5939481f8
created 2012-06-20 17:36 -0700
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Merge from mozilla-central.
a15a3a3b4647fa24609d08706ea35e9cd5998c52
created 2012-05-23 14:33 -0700
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Merge from mozilla-central.
80e4ab0d24bc64ceaa7693ab5def36faffde7a40
created 2012-05-21 14:40 -0700
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Merge from mozilla-central.
1a9e91a88a5488d15b39a0530c326fdb1e1ce77b
created 2012-02-24 13:26 -0800
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Merge from mozilla-central.
132462b85b08292526d3c3d87ecffe552ac81727
created 2012-02-14 15:04 -0800
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Merge from mozilla-central.
8e182985f782e8ec3b3872d2c927ba9e63c156b3
created 2012-01-17 14:05 -0800
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Merge from mozilla-central.
a64147b4cccbdecd64ad218625df24981f5e86c5
created 2011-11-29 16:44 -0800
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Merge from mozilla-central.
8cfeba5239a9e4f20c462d6fb20421b4e4e7c735
created 2011-10-05 19:52 -0700
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Merge to eliminate bad head.
cad26d2fb5af799dfe030fd2a8948d617eac2f52
created 2011-10-05 18:37 -0700
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Backout merge.
a16372ce30b5f6b747246b01fcd215a4bf3b6342
created 2012-08-22 11:56 -0400
pushed 2012-08-22 16:03 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g
c35d2d3071aca855d65348b646f154794275312d
created 2012-06-22 18:27 -0700
pushed 2012-06-23 12:36 +0000
Chris Jones Chris Jones - Bug 761927: Fix focus for <iframe mozbrowser remote>. r=jlebar,Enn
01f3e0c756b0de4b0bedb4a037efab8156f2cd71
created 2012-06-14 22:31 -0400
pushed 2012-06-19 08:15 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 758992 - Make the classes which use the XPCOM nsISupports implementation macros final, to avoid the warning about deleting using a pointer to a base class with virtual functions and no virtual dtor (dom parts); r=bzbarsky
fb5b2c7e1b9b8ba8d1e28e2a1381842ec0dde475
created 2012-05-23 08:48 +0900
pushed 2012-05-23 09:43 +0000
Alexander Surkov Alexander Surkov - Bug 756973 - make RootAccessible::NativeState faster, r=tbsaunde, enn
219dc3f47568048c45f829b18537b3701046d419
created 2012-05-22 18:25 +0900
pushed 2012-05-23 09:43 +0000
Alexander Surkov Alexander Surkov - Bug 756381 - make FocusManager::FocusedDOMNode faster, r=tbsaunde, smaug
f4157e8c410708d76703f19e4dfb61859bfe32d8
created 2012-05-21 12:12 +0100
pushed 2012-05-21 11:54 +0000
Gervase Markham Gervase Markham - Bug 716478 - update licence to MPL 2.
c97dcc479c62edbc869be699879d90b10e4c5f4d
created 2012-02-23 16:02 -0500
pushed 2012-02-24 10:23 +0000
Neil Deakin Neil Deakin - Bug 653230, add panels with focusable elements into the document tab navigation order, r=smaug
5185e21c55ec3abacf098b4069e0fd953a6353e1
created 2012-02-13 14:24 -0500
pushed 2012-02-14 10:17 +0000
Neil Deakin Neil Deakin - Bug 670317, add a focus manager flag to restrict tab navigation to the same frame, r=smaug
742d5f9f284db15da07f0cac485fef9f9606fb64
created 2012-01-13 14:42 +0200
pushed 2012-01-13 13:27 +0000
Olli Pettay Olli Pettay - Bug 704583 - Add testing mode to FocusManager, p=enn,smaug r=smaug,enn
a1b2a561db2bb7896d322b8ef9a7910c642cdc6e
created 2011-11-27 20:51 +0900
pushed 2011-11-28 13:11 +0000
Masayuki Nakano Masayuki Nakano - Bug 685395 part.3 Rename SetInputMode()/GetInputMode() to SetInputContext()/GetInputContext() and make SetInputContext() take the reason by a separated argument r=roc, sr=matspal
e7854b4d29ba905ae3994f821b160c989bac4260
created 2011-09-28 23:19 -0700
pushed 2011-09-29 08:20 +0000
Michael Wu Michael Wu -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ones
238b9a9479ed090b134d80ee8984855ec4746129
created 2011-06-17 17:08 -0700
pushed 2011-07-08 15:21 +0000
Felipe Gomes Felipe Gomes - Bug 583976. Part 1 - Add focus manager support for focus activation/deactivation in remote content. r=enn,smaug
317d287b6db82c4ce8cb79e2d2b171cb4e08b8b9
created 2011-07-01 16:28 +0200
pushed 2011-07-01 14:31 +0000
Marco Bonardo Marco Bonardo - Backout due to mobile failures these changesets: 9f451a1901dd, e99f86ba7278, 447b48b79e6a, cef046665c53, c9237cc1fae0, d77a331a6d5a, f8f3afb95355, a050168887ee, 3ec4303ebf4d, 671b7c0d99f0, 56b17efbb62b, beceddeee3f4 on a CLOSED TREE
c9237cc1fae0b708b99f9abc2745371e1f96f035
created 2011-06-17 17:08 -0700
pushed 2011-07-01 03:59 +0000
Felipe Gomes Felipe Gomes - Bug 583976. Part 1 - Add focus manager support for focus activation/deactivation in remote content. r=enn,smaug
3a4140939fc40e8be58c68f300a037d7aded26f0
created 2011-05-31 21:46 -0400
pushed 2011-06-01 08:12 +0000
Boris Zbarsky Boris Zbarsky - Bug 598833 part 5. Store focus and focusring state directly on elements. r=smaug,enn
aed1a67f173878f5897ab5a9aacfd6ab9cabe528
created 2011-04-20 14:47 +0200
pushed 2011-04-20 12:48 +0000
Vivien Nicolas Vivien Nicolas - Bug 532738 - Do not open the virtual keyboard on untrusted focus (caused by content page scripts) [r=masayuki]
9722ce9b7c3d98f2bdd5b25ca9bd7733f994ec71
created 2011-03-25 11:03 -0400
pushed 2011-03-25 15:04 +0000
Benjamin Smedberg Benjamin Smedberg - Bug 617539 - Integrate nsIFocusManager_MOZILLA_2_0_BRANCH back into the main interface, r=smaug
1950375b2ec2dc553db3a7c3225dbfdcc5d7bc69
created 2010-11-15 15:12 -0600
pushed 2010-11-15 21:13 +0000
Steven Michaud Steven Michaud - Bug 601182 - Spurious focus events sent to NPAPI plugins on OS X in Cocoa event mode. Patch partly by enndeakin. r=josh,smaug a=blocking2.0BetaN+
261ca48443c0a662491fa204ed24e3640d1ca8e1
created 2010-11-06 14:04 +0900
pushed 2010-11-06 05:08 +0000
Masayuki Nakano Masayuki Nakano - Bug 591890 focus() method should be able to steal focus when it's called from mousedown event handler r=enndeakin, a=betaN+
8e4846fc62e4b3759d9143f39987555f5fb24ab6
created 2010-10-18 11:12 -0700
pushed 2010-10-18 18:13 +0000
Drew Willcoxon Drew Willcoxon - Bug 596698 - Link target in location bar isn't updated when switching between tabs if link is focused. r=enndeakin, a=blocking2.0-final
10e893c36559082f66627e2846a47f9da11b34bd
created 2010-08-09 12:15 -0400
pushed 2010-08-09 16:16 +0000
Neil Deakin Neil Deakin - Bug 577316, add preference to allow form elements to be focused when clicked, r=smaug
ca431b0a982c417fab797d0a2bf25e9f818aeb27
created 2010-04-27 12:58 +0300
pushed 2010-04-27 11:47 +0000
Olli Pettay Olli Pettay - Bug 560902 - Optimize nsFocusManager::ContentRemoved, r=enndeakin+sicking
f3abfe490d7f6cf1883cbed3fe86b9bdddc64d6e
created 2010-04-21 10:53 -0400
pushed 2010-04-21 14:54 +0000
Neil Deakin Neil Deakin - Bug 418521, improve the way focus indicators are displayed to correlate better with system behaviour, add -moz-focusring property to apply only when focus rings should be drawn, r=dao,jmathies,dbaron sr=neil
b5971d748a2221a4291a7c3d7bbf9c1bc3ce5fd9
created 2010-04-21 22:13 +0900
pushed 2010-04-21 13:14 +0000
Masayuki Nakano Masayuki Nakano - Bug 544277 IME became unusable when switching focus on Gmail RTF Editor r=enn
641a22b4100a85a21b610eb207617515880cbe25
created 2009-12-21 21:50 +0000
pushed 2009-12-21 21:51 +0000
Metal Sonic Metal Sonic - Bug 507387 - fix copyright holder; Mozilla Corporation -> Mozilla Foundation. r=gerv.
a8f46161c8918595239ea24a1d5e364d6f6948b6
created 2009-12-12 14:17 +0900
pushed 2009-12-12 05:18 +0000
Masayuki Nakano Masayuki Nakano - Bug 125282 Webpage-JS can steal focus from URLbar / chrome r=enndeakin
bacd85de3ef8f01f583f270851334dc7d055b7d9
created 2009-11-20 14:09 +0200
pushed 2009-11-20 12:09 +0000
enndeakin enndeakin - Bug 525856 - White-space in source code affects how link receive focus from keyboard (tab key), r=smaug, sr=roc
d9267e3d8f8ce92417f15dd0311fa33d83fd11ee
created 2009-10-01 14:53 -0300
pushed 2009-10-01 18:01 +0000
Neil Deakin Neil Deakin - Bug 513299, add a flag to focus events to indicate that a window was raised, fixes issue where text in a field is selected when a window is raised, r=smaug.sr=neil
f555ee21c59a3961e45a3bdaa1d5419412d2829c
created 2009-08-13 19:09 -0700
pushed 2009-08-14 02:10 +0000
L. David Baron L. David Baron - Don't QI a node to nsIDOMElement and back to nsIContent for every call to nsEventStateManager::GetContentState. (Bug 509889) r=enndeakin
45cf3a994809f65760d98b6891e46bcf706d8799
created 2009-06-20 20:04 -0400
pushed 2009-06-21 00:04 +0000
Neil Deakin Neil Deakin - Bug 498609 and 498643, clear focused element when not in document, sr=smaug
cabb8925dcd3d831a244b01e0a37c29b8793c77b
created 2009-06-10 14:00 -0400
pushed 2009-06-10 18:01 +0000
Neil Deakin Neil Deakin - Bug 178324, refactor focus by moving all focus handling into one place and simplifying it, add many tests, fixes many other bugs too numerous to mention in this small checkin comment, r=josh,smichaud,ere,dbaron,marco,neil,gavin,smaug,sr=smaug (CLOSED TREE)
less more (0) tip